WebFeb 16, 2024 · If you have constant heartburn, you should schedule an appointment with a gastroenterologist. Heartburn symptoms include: Burning sensation in the chest or throat. A sour taste in the mouth. Difficulty swallowing. Feeling like food is stuck in the throat. Regurgitation of stomach contents into the mouth. Nausea or vomiting.
